Antibiotic stewardship is continuously evolving to incorporate results from novel research, clinical findings, and specialist recommendations. Numerous dedicated information sources, including web-based solutions, are available to keep medical practitioners informed. However, the provided information is often extensive, requiring users to extract the relevant facts. This study aimed to deliver an information platform that provides references, links, and information in a straightforward and engaging manner. Implementing a high-fidelity prototype prioritized medical and patient-oriented functionalities, structured around questions and quizzes. Additionally, the platform offers access to professional references, such as official healthcare guidelines and scientific articles. The development process adhered to design principles and included user testing with established usability measures (SUS, Nielsen's heuristics), resulting in satisfactory scores from IT experts and somewhat lower scores from users. Although designed to cater to a broader range of users, more work is needed to improve usability for the general public.
